Kirsty Williams welcomes lottery grants

April 27, 2006 1:23 PM

Welsh Liberal Democrat AM for Brecon and Radnorshire, Kirsty Williams, has congratulated two very different organisations in the constituency on being awarded Heritage Lottery Fund grants.

Knighton Town Forum and the Wales Trekking and Riding Association have both been awarded grants under the Awards for All Wales programme to help develop heritage projects.

Ms Williams said: "I am delighted to see that these important projects are to receive some help and recognition. The preservation of our heritage is vitally important for the education of future generations and for the development of our tourist industry, which is so important to the Welsh economy."

Notes:

Knighton Town Forum has been awarded £500 to help cover the cost of promoting and publicising activities to celebrate the link between the town and Lord Nelson, and commemorate the 200th anniversary of the battle of Trafalgar.

Wales Trekking and Riding Association, based in Llanwrtyd Wells, has been awarded £4,996 to establish a mobile exhibition displaying the history of Welsh pony trekking.
